Cottonwick Villa


 

Cottonwick finished a complete rebuild in 2016 and now offers everything that a honeymoon couple, team of friends or family with children could want from a medium-sized villa. Three equally proportioned, ensuite bedrooms open to the centrally positioned swimming pool in the heart of the house.

The ‘Great Room’ combines a dining table with seating capacity for 8-10 at one end with sofas and an entertainment system on the other. To the rear of the property is an outside dining area under a timber pergola. The relaxing sound of trickling water permeates throughout, from the cascading feature pools to the front and the garden cascade plunge pool to the rear.

The Beaches


There really are not many places that have beaches as beautiful, as varied or as uncrowded as those on Mustique.  Despite its small it packs in an incredible amount of diverse places to explore, have picnics at, swim, dive or snorkel or find somewhere that offers you the sort of privacy you would expect on a private beach.

Cotton House Beach: At the heart of the island it has the beach cafe, diving and watersports centre, deck chairs and calm waters for swimming and snokelling.

Macaroni:   The beach with tghe waves and where you will find just about every teenager between the age of 12 and 24.   A really fun beach with great surf for bogey boarding or just bouncing in the water.

Geliceaux:   Below what was Princess Margrets house.   ccess by a headland path it is one of the most private beaches on the island.

Briatannia Bay:   Overlooked by the Basil's Bar and beyond the white sand beach is an incredibly snorkelling experience where you will swim with countless turtles.  

Lagoon: Super calm, Lagoon is perfect for very young children as well as be an excellent venue for beach picnic at one of the huts.   

Pasture Bay:    Maybe the most specatcular beach with its vast expanse of beach it is one of the popular picnic spots where you can take in the raw energy of the Atlantic Ocean, unrestrained by a reef.

Getting to Mustique


Daily flights operate between St Lucia and Mustique which are scheduled to allow afternoon connections from most European & US destinations. On arrival into St Lucia you will be fast-tracked through customs, given assistance with your luggage and with minimal delay be on your way.   The charter flight from St Lucia is a short but scenic 20 min journey to Mustique.   You will be met by Gemey and in the house 15 mins after touching down on Mustique!

There are also twice weekly scheduled flights that operate from Barbados and private charter flights are available.
